Core Energy‑Saving Technical Principles of Magnetic Bearing Turbo Blowers
Frictionless Magnetic Bearing Structure Reduces Invalid Energy Consumption
Traditional blowers rely on contact‑type mechanical bearings. Continuous operation brings friction loss, heat generation and component abrasion, wasting large volumes of electric power within mechanical transmission paths. Equipped with electromagnetic suspension technology, the magnetic bearing turbo blower keeps its rotor fully levitated without physical contact. It eliminates friction‑related energy loss at hardware level, marking its core advantage over legacy blowers.
This unit runs oil‑free without lubricating oil. It prevents oil contamination of process air and cuts auxiliary power and spending on oil pumps and oil replacement, streamlines overall plant energy footprint.
High‑Speed Direct Drive Transmission Realizes Zero Power Loss
Legacy Roots blowers and ordinary centrifugal blowers apply belt or gear transmission, causing power attenuation and energy waste. Our magnetic bearing turbo blower adopts high‑speed motor direct‑coupled drive and removes intermediate transmission parts. Power transfer happens with zero loss. Motor energy efficiency rises significantly. Under identical air‑flow and pressure conditions, the unit requires lower input power and cuts daily power draw.
Intelligent Frequency Conversion Adapts to Working Conditions for Accurate Energy Control
Plant production loads keep changing. Fixed‑speed traditional blowers maintain full‑power output under partial‑load conditions and produce severe power waste. The magnetic bearing turbo blower integrates an intelligent blower control system. This variable‑speed unit dynamically adjusts rotation speed and air output responding to real‑time aeration or process air demand. Wide‑range modulation from 20%‑100% matches shifting site conditions and eliminates unnecessary power consumption.

Practical Energy‑Saving Advantages Under Different Factory Working Conditions
Factories With 24‑Hour Continuous Production
Sewage treatment, chemical and building‑material plants operate year‑round non‑stop with blowers running at heavy load. As a continuous duty turbo blower, the magnetic bearing turbo blower sustains high efficiency without performance decay caused by heating or component wear. Day‑to‑day operation accumulates substantial power‑saving gains, perfectly matching non‑stop industrial scenarios.
Factories With Fluctuating Production Loads
Food, pharmaceutical and light‑manufacturing sites face shifting production volumes and unstable air demand. The built‑in intelligent blower control system reacts to changing working parameters and modulates power output dynamically. It avoids waste generated by fixed‑speed legacy blowers and supports factory daily power consumption reduction.
Factories With High‑Temperature and High‑Humidity Workshop Environment
Many blower rooms operate under hot‑humid conditions, which degrade performance and raise failure rates for conventional blowers. Our magnetic bearing turbo blower passes strict condition‑adaptation testing. It retains stable efficiency inside harsh plant environments and avoids extra power loss triggered by poor ambient conditions.
Low Operation and Maintenance Costs Indirectly Reduce Comprehensive Factory Energy Consumption
Total factory energy‑related expenditure covers not only electricity bills, but also indirect losses from maintenance, unplanned downtime and spare‑part renewal. Thanks to its optimized mechanical layout, magnetic bearing turbo blower delivers multiple low‑cost operating merits:
Ultra‑low noise operation: Low vibration and noise remove requirements for bulky extra silencing hardware, cutting auxiliary equipment investment and power draw
Maintenance‑free design: Oil‑free construction removes frequent oil and seal replacement, shortening maintenance downtime, securing continuous production and preventing energy loss from shutdown‑restart cycles
Extended service life: Near‑zero friction extends main unit service life, lowering equipment renewal frequency and overall plant capital spending
